Fake ‘Minister Hayward’ TikTok Account

June 6, 2025 | 2 Comments

The Ministry of Economy and Labour advised “that a fraudulent TikTok account has been created using the name and image of the Minister of Economy and Labour Jason Hayward.”

A Government spokesperson said, “The account in question, located here, is not authorised, endorsed, or operated by Minister Hayward or the Ministry. It was created to mislead the public by impersonating the Minister.

“Minister Hayward does not have a TikTok account and any content posted under this profile should be regarded as false and misleading.”

Minister Hayward said, “It is deeply concerning that someone would attempt to impersonate a public official to deceive others. I urge everyone to be vigilant and verify social media accounts’ authenticity before engaging with them.”

The Government spokesperson said, “The public is reminded to rely only on official information and advisories from the Government of Bermuda’s official communication section, the Department of Communications.”
